Summary
Removes provisions that prohibit an individual who performs services (other than in an instructional, research, or principal administrative capacity) for an educational institution, in an educational institution while in the employ of an educational service agency, or for a government, nonprofit, or private employer that provides services to an educational institution, from being eligible to receive an unemployment insurance benefit during vacation periods and between academic years or terms.
Title
Unemployment insurance.
